How To Make One-Pan Egg Breakfast Burger

  • Cook the Bacon – Start by placing your bacon strips in a cold pan. Turn the heat to medium and cook until they’re golden and crispy. Set them aside on a paper towel to drain.
  • Toast the Buns – In a separate dry pan (no oil needed), toast both halves of the burger bun cut-side down until lightly golden and crisp. Remove and set aside.
  • Cook the Eggs & Add the Buns -Lightly oil a non-stick pan and pour in the egg mixture over medium-low heat. Let the eggs begin to set. Before they’re fully cooked, place the top bun half cut side down and the bottom bun half facing up directly onto the eggs.
Burger buns placed cut-side down on gently cooking eggs in a lightly oiled non-stick pan over medium-low heat.
  • Flip It – Once the egg is mostly set and golden underneath, gently flip the whole thing so the buns are now on the bottom and the cooked egg is on top.
  • Add Your Fillings – While everything is still warm in the pan, layer on a slice of cheddar cheese, a fresh lettuce leaf, three crispy bacon strips, two slices of tomato, and two red onion rings.
Fresh cheddar cheese, lettuce, crispy bacon, tomato slices, and red onion rings layered on top of a warm egg and burger buns in a pan.
  • Fold & Finish – Carefully fold the buns together into a sandwich. Press lightly and let it sit in the pan for about 30 seconds to warm through and let the cheese melt.
  • Serve & Enjoy – Plate your burger and dig in while it’s hot, melty, and absolutely delicious.

Tips for Success

  • Use a non-stick pan to make flipping the buns and eggs easier without sticking or breaking.
  • Cook the bacon first so it’s nice and crispy, then use the same pan for that extra flavor when toasting the buns and cooking the eggs.
  • Keep the heat medium-low when cooking the eggs to get that perfect soft, tender texture without burning.
  • Be gentle when flipping—try sliding a spatula under the buns and eggs all at once for a smooth flip.
  • Let the cheese melt by pressing the sandwich lightly and giving it a quick extra minute in the pan.
  • Feel free to customize! Add avocado, hot sauce, or your favorite greens for an extra kick.

Customizations Tips

  • Add a spoon of spicy mayo or sriracha for extra heat
  • Swap cheddar with gouda or mozzarella for a different cheese vibe
  • Not a fan of raw onion? Lightly sauté it for sweetness
  • Want it vegetarian? Skip the bacon and add avocado or grilled mushrooms

Instructions
 

  • Start by cooking the bacon in a pan over medium heat until it's golden and crispy. Once done, place it on a paper towel to drain the excess oil.
  • In a clean, dry pan, toast the burger buns cut-side down until they're nicely golden and slightly crisp. No oil is needed for this step. Set the buns aside.
  • Crack the eggs into a bowl and whisk them together with a pinch of chili flakes, salt, and black pepper.
  • Lightly oil a non-stick pan and pour in the egg mixture over medium-low heat. Let it cook for a few seconds until the eggs begin to set.
  • While the eggs are still soft, place the top bun half cut side down and the bottom bun half facing up directly onto the eggs. Let it cook like this until the egg is mostly set underneath.
  • Carefully flip the entire thing so the buns are now on the bottom and the egg is on top.
  • Add the fillings by layering a slice of cheddar cheese, a fresh lettuce leaf, three crispy bacon strips, two slices of tomato, and two rings of red onion on top of the egg.
  • Gently fold the buns together into a sandwich, press lightly, and let it sit in the pan for another 30 seconds so the cheese melts and everything comes together.
  • Serve hot and enjoy your crispy egg-wrapped breakfast burger!

Notes

  • Nutrition values will vary based on the exact brands and ingredients used (especially the bacon, cheese, and buns).
  • For a lighter version, you can use turkey bacon, low-fat cheese, or whole grain/light buns.
  • To make it gluten-free, use gluten-free burger buns.
  • For an extra fiber boost, add avocado or spinach!
